March For The Missing

The charity Missing People provides some support and advice and maintains a register of missing people. Importantly, they recognise the right of people to go missing and stay missing. But the organisers of today's march, mothers searching for lost sons, say there is a real need for emotional and practical support for families searching for lost relatives and stuck in the limbo of not knowing what's happened to them. They are marching on Downing Street to campaign for the government to provide this, in the shape of a support network or Missing Persons Bill.
A single daffodil is to be lain remembrance of those missing.
